What Does an ENT Specialist Do?

An ENT specialist, also known as an otolaryngologist, treats disorders and diseases related to:

  • Ear: Hearing loss, ear infections, tinnitus, and balance issues
  • Nose: Allergies, sinusitis, nasal polyps, deviated septum, and breathing problems
  • Throat: Sore throats, voice disorders, swallowing difficulties, and tonsillitis
  • Head and Neck: Tumors, trauma, facial injuries, and congenital disorders

ENT doctors are trained to manage both medical and surgical treatments, making them the go-to professionals for a wide array of upper respiratory tract issues.

Common ENT Issues and Symptoms

1. Chronic Sinus Infections

A sinus infection, or sinusitis, occurs when the nasal cavities become swollen or inflamed. While most infections resolve on their own, chronic sinusitis persists for 12 weeks or longer despite treatment. Symptoms include:

  • Facial pain or pressure
  • Congested or runny nose
  • Post-nasal drip
  • Headaches
  • Reduced sense of smell

2. Recurring Ear Infections

Children and adults alike can suffer from frequent ear infections, which may lead to hearing loss or balance problems if left untreated. Warning signs include:

  • Ear pain or discomfort
  • Difficulty hearing
  • Fluid discharge from the ear
  • Dizziness or balance issues
  • Irritability in children

Persistent or severe infections require evaluation by an ENT specialist for possible treatments like antibiotics or ear tube insertion.

3. Hearing Loss

Gradual or sudden hearing loss is often misunderstood as a normal part of aging. However, there could be underlying causes such as:

  • Impacted earwax
  • Middle ear infections
  • Noise-induced damage
  • Age-related hearing loss (presbycusis)
  • Inner ear disorders like Meniere’s disease

4. Tonsillitis and Sore Throat

Tonsillitis is the inflammation of the tonsils, usually due to viral or bacterial infections. Common symptoms include:

  • Sore throat
  • Difficulty swallowing
  • Swollen tonsils
  • Fever
  • White patches on tonsils

5. Nasal Obstruction or Deviated Septum

Breathing through your nose should be effortless. If you constantly feel congested or breathe better from one side, a deviated nasal septum might be the cause. Symptoms include:

  • Blocked nostrils
  • Noisy breathing during sleep
  • Frequent nosebleeds
  • Snoring

6. Voice and Swallowing Disorders

People who use their voice extensively—such as teachers, singers, and public speakers—are at higher risk of developing vocal cord issues. Signs of voice disorders include:

  • Hoarseness
  • Throat pain while speaking
  • Persistent cough or throat clearing

When Should You Visit an ENT Specialist?

1. When Symptoms Persist Beyond a Few Days

Cold and allergy symptoms that don’t improve after a week could indicate sinusitis or a more serious ENT issue.

2. When Over-the-Counter Medication Fails

If antihistamines, decongestants, or pain relievers don’t ease your discomfort, it’s time for a proper evaluation.

3. When Symptoms Interfere with Daily Life

Frequent sore throats, ear infections, or voice issues can hamper your personal and professional life. Seeking timely treatment ensures better outcomes.

4. If You Experience Sudden Symptoms

Sudden hearing loss, vertigo, or nosebleeds warrant immediate medical attention from an ENT specialist.

5. For Preventive Screenings

Regular ENT checkups are important if you have a history of allergies, snoring, or chronic ENT conditions. Early detection often leads to easier management.

Tips for Maintaining Good ENT Health

  1. Stay Hydrated: Keeps mucous membranes moist and reduces irritation.
  2. Avoid Smoking: Tobacco harms throat tissues and increases infection risk.
  3. Use Humidifiers: Prevents dryness in nasal passages and throat.
  4. Protect Your Ears: Avoid loud music and use ear protection in noisy environments.
  5. Manage Allergies: Follow treatment plans and avoid known allergens.
